Incumbents Won't Answer Questions Print E-mail
Written by Will   
Wednesday, 06 February 2008

The launch of the new Arnold Election site has seen a nice welcome to the community.  The traffic is steady, and people are finding out more about the candidates they may be voting on.

Brinnon Morrison and Matt Hay (both newcomers) have already filed their interview questions .  They are eager to help the community, they are already active and pressing towards their goal.  Both of these gentlemen read the forums here at AT, and are willing to answer any questions their voters may have.

The same, however, can't be said for the incumbents... 

Mrs. Deckman has been provided with the same questions as Mr. Morrison, yet has never replied with answers.  Mr. Brazeal has been offered the questions as well, but no answer.  (For the record, Mr. Poor was provided with the questions just this week, and I believe he is actively answering them.  We should hear from him hopefully by next week.)

So why don't/won't the incumbents answer the AT survey?  Do they not believe that AT affects the community?  They read the site (trust me, they do) but act as if it doesn't exist.  Do they have the community's best in their heart?  Perhaps they do, but we may never know.

Perhaps they think being an incumbent automatically buys them votes.  Maybe they think the people at the polls will just vote for whoever is already there.  I doubt it.  More people in this community are involved than they may think.  And people aren't happy with the way Arnold is headed.

Next time you see one of the incumbents, ask them why they won't answer the questionnaire.  Heck, it's a good opportunity for them to promote their past and current 'doings'.  So why aren't they?
